The 2022 summer circuit has finished up and we are now onto the last graduating HS class for our summer rankings updates. We conclude with an expanded list of 200 players for the 2023 class

With one more year of HS baseball left, the 2023 class was heavily impacted by covid-19 and a large chunk of uncommitted talent remains on the board.

Rankings are based on evaluations by scouting director Dan Jurik as well as additional PBR scouts across the country who have seen prospects from the state at various events. 

With a majority of the prospects on the list uncommitted, the goal is for this information to help assist  college coaches as they look to finalize their recruiting classes and add additional pieces to their roster.
